Muscat Stock Exchange (MSX) general index (30) today gained (46.4) points, comprising a rise by (1.01%) to close at (4648.67) points, compared to the last session, which stood at (4602.25) points. The trading value today stood at (RO 1,416,425), comprising a drop by (39.8%), compared to the last session, which stood at (RO 2,351,439). The report released by MSX pointed out that the market value went up by (0.362%) to reach about (RO 24.39) billion. The report added that the value of shares bought by non-Omani investors reached (RO 98,000), comprising (14.01%). The value of shares sold by non-Omani investors reached (RO 374,000), comprising (26.38%). The net non-Omani investment decreased by (12.36%) to (RO 175,000). Source: Oman News Agency
